📰 What Happened

Iran's rial has dropped to a record low against the U.S. dollar as the U.S. prepares to impose new sanctions. This decline reflects the ongoing economic challenges Iran faces amid increasing international scrutiny.

  • The rial has reached its lowest value ever against the dollar.
  • New U.S. sanctions are expected to further strain Iran's economy.

📚 Background

Iran has been facing economic challenges for several years, largely due to U.S. sanctions and mismanagement. The rial's value is a key indicator of the country's economic health.
